matlab符號運算

2022-09-04 22:03:16 字數 725 閱讀 5024

sym打頭與符號相關

定義符號物件

sym  syms:

f=sym('arg')將數字、字串和表示式arg轉換成符號物件f

syms('arg1','arg2','arg3',......)將符號 arg1 arg2 arg3...定義為基本符號物件

syms arg1 arg2 同上

符號表示式累計求和

symsum(s)

symsum(s,v)

symsum(s,a,b)

合併同類項:

collect(s)  預設對x進行合併同類項

collect(s,v)  對v進行合併同類項

因式分解:

factor()

化簡:simplify()

變數確定:

symvar()

符號微積分:

求極限limit(f,x,a)

limit(f,a)預設自變數=a的極限

limit(f) 在x=0的極限

limit(f,x,a,'right/left')求左右極限

求導:diff(f)對x一階導

diff(f,2)對x的二階導

diff(f,y)對y一階導

積分int(f)

int(f,a,b)

符號代數方程的求解

線性方程組的求解

linsolve

一般代數方程組的求解

solve

Matlab符號運算

一 宣告 宣告單個符號變數 sym a 宣告多個符號變數 syms a b c 二 符號表示式 提取分子分母 n,d numdem a 自變數為 v的符號函式的反函式 finverse f,v 求和 symsum s,v,a,b 三 符號表示式化簡 以直觀漂亮的形式顯示 pretty f 合併同類項...

matlab符號運算基礎

sym與syms 區別1 如果定義變數x,syms x 當用sym生成多個符號變數時,matlab要報錯 syms函式的功能比sym函式更為強大,它可以一次建立任意多個符號變數.而且,syms函式的使用格式也很簡單,使用格式如下 syms var1 var2 var3 如 syms x y z 區別...

MATLAB學習之符號運算

本文介紹matlab中的符號運算 符號常量是不含變數的符號表示式,用 sym 命令來建立符號常量。a sym sin 2 sym 命令也可以把數值轉換成某種格式的符號常量。建立數值常量和符號常量 a1 3 sqrt 5 pi 建立數值常量 a2 sym 3 sqrt 5 pi 建立符號表示式 a3 ...